构建高效Web开发Linux服务器环境指南

AI绘图,仅供参考

在构建高效Web开发Linux服务器环境时,选择合适的操作系统是关键。Ubuntu和CentOS是两种广泛使用的发行版,它们都提供了稳定的环境和丰富的软件包支持。根据项目需求和个人偏好进行选择。

安装基础工具可以显著提升开发效率。例如,安装Git用于版本控制,SSH用于远程连接,以及常用的文本编辑器如Vim或Nano。•安装Build-essential包可提供编译源代码所需的依赖项。

配置Web服务器是核心步骤之一。Nginx和Apache是两个主流选择,Nginx以其高性能和低资源占用著称,而Apache则在模块化和灵活性方面表现更佳。根据应用场景选择合适的服务器软件并进行合理配置。

数据库的选择同样重要。MySQL和PostgreSQL是常见的关系型数据库,而MongoDB适合处理非结构化数据。安装后需进行安全设置,如修改默认端口、设置强密码和限制访问权限。

•部署和监控工具能帮助开发者更好地管理服务器。使用Supervisor或Systemd管理进程,结合Prometheus和Grafana进行性能监控,确保服务稳定运行。

dawei

【声明】:天津站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复